Terpene phenolic resin represents a phenolic - modified resin, which serves to enhance polarity. It has the capacity to enhance the specific adhesion, hot - tack, or flexibility of either hot - melt or solvent - based adhesives.

Applications:
-EVA - based hot - melt adhesives utilized in packaging, bookbinding, woodworking, and labeling.
-SIS and SBS - based hot - melt pressure - sensitive adhesives.
-Sealants formulated with butyl rubber or polyurethane.
-Solvent - based adhesives prepared with acrylics or natural rubber.
-Rubber compounding and in the production of tires.
Properties:
-Exhibits stronger tackifying properties compared to other resins.
-Demonstrates excellent heat resistance and color stability.
-Displays broad compatibility, being capable of being blended with numerous high - polymer resins over a wide range and being soluble in many polar or non - polar solvents.
Solubility:
-Soluble in aromatic/aliphatic solvents such as hexane and toluene.
-Soluble in esters and ketones like ethyl acetate and acetone.
-Soluble in longer - chain alcohols including propanol, pentanol, and butanol.
-Insoluble in water and ethanol.
Compatibility:
Compatible with ethylene, butyl acrylate copolymers, natural rubbers, and synthetic rubbers (SIS, SBS, SBR, chloroprene, butyl), polyesters, and acrylics. It is also compatible with various resins (rosin derivatives, polyterpene resins, hydrocarbon resins) and waxes.
